Chikhali is a Rural village located in Sondawa, Alirajpur, Madhya-pradesh.
The total population of Chikhali is 1,043.
Chikhali village comprises 187 households.
The literacy rate in Chikhali is 32.3%. Among the literate population of 262, there are 169 literate males and 93 literate females.
In Chikhali, there are 518 males and 525 females, with a sex ratio of 1014 females per 1000 males.
There are 233 children (22.3% of population), comprising 108 boys and 125 girls.
The total number of workers in Chikhali is 563, with 545 main workers and 18 marginal workers.
In Chikhali,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 1,043 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(518 males, 525 females).
Chikhali is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Alirajpur district, and falls under Sondawa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 505374 and LGD code is 505374.
